Elderly Cyclist Killed In Cherry Hill Crash: Police

The 76-year-old man succumbed to his injuries after being taken to the hospital, authorities said.

CHERRY HILL, NJ — An elderly cyclist died from his injuries following a Monday night crash in Cherry Hill, police said.

The collision occurred at about 9:15 p.m. on Route 70 westbound by Cuthbert Boulevard. A vehicle struck a bicyclist moving in the same direction, while both were in the right lane, according to Cherry Hill Police Lt. Thomas Leone.

The driver stayed at the scene and called for emergency assistance. The cyclist — a 76-year-old man — was transported to Cooper Hospital and has since succumbed to his injuries, Leone said.

Police haven't publicly identified anyone involved.

The Cherry Hill Police Department's Traffic Safety Unit continues to investigate the collision.

Monday's incident marks Cherry Hill's third fatal crash since Aug. 28, according to state records.
